(Oral) The grievance of the petitioner-a Residents Welfare Society is against the alleged non availability of basic amenities to be provided by the builder-cum-developer from whom the residential apartments were purchased by its members. The petitioner-Society seeks intervention of the State-authorities, namely, respondent Nos.2 to 6 in the matter and take appropriate action so that the promised basic amenities are restored to the Apartment-owners. Since the petitioner-Society has approached none of the above-named authorities so far, its learned counsel submits that let this writ petition be treated as a representation on behalf of the petitioner-Society for its consideration by the authorities.

CWP No.21377 of 2015 [2] We thus dispose of this writ petition at this stage with a direction to respondent Nos.3 to 6 to treat this petition as a representation on behalf of the petitioner-Society and take necessary steps as may be required in accordance with law, after observing the principles of natural justice. Let the needful be done within a period of four months from the date of receiving a certified copy of this order alongwith a copy of the writ petition. Petitioner-Society is directed to deposit six copies of the paper book with the Registry for onward transmission to the respondents.
Ordered accordingly.
